SQL开发知识:SQL Server Management Studio复制数据库的方法

1. SQL Server Management Studio 复制数据库方法

SQL Server Management Studio(SSMS)是SQL Server数据库管理系统的主要工具。它可以通过复制数据库来轻松创建数据库或将数据库从一个地方移动到另一个地方。

1.1 创建新数据库

如果您想创建新数据库并将其从现有数据库复制,则可以使用SSMS执行以下步骤:

1.右键单击现有数据库,然后选择“复制”。

2.在“复制数据库向导”对话框中,输入新数据库的名称。选择目标服务器,并选择“将数据库中的所有对象复制到新数据库中”。

3.设置其他选项(如果需要),然后单击“完成”。

此时,您的新数据库已成功复制到目标服务器上。

1.2 复制现有数据库

如果您想在同一服务器上创建当前已存在的数据库副本,则可以使用SSMS执行以下步骤:

1.右键单击现有数据库,然后选择“任务”和“生成脚本”。

2.在“生成脚本向导”对话框中,选择要复制的对象和选项。如果需要复制整个数据库,则需要选择“选择所有”选项。

3.在“高级选项”中选择“生成DROP语句”和“生成CREATE语句”选项,并在“输出选项”中选择“新查询编辑器窗口”或“文件”。然后单击“下一步”。

4.设置其他选项(如果需要),然后单击“下一步”。

5.查看脚本,然后单击“完成”。

此时,您的现有数据库已成功复制。

1.3 注意事项

当你复制一个数据库时,可能会遇到以下问题:

1.如果原始数据库使用了文件群组,则必须确保在复制它时复制所有文件群组。

2.如果目标服务器上存在同名的数据库,则必须更改要创建的新数据库的名称或删除同名的数据库。

3.确保在复制数据库之前备份数据库,以防在复制过程中发生错误。

SSMS使数据库复制变得非常容易。遵循上述步骤,您将能够在不需要编写任何代码的情况下复制现有数据库或创建全新数据库。

数据库标签